Amps are pretty basic, it could only be a couple things keeping it from coming on. Since you tried jumping the remote wire from the 12v and it still didnt come on, it has to be that the amp is not seeing 12v power or its still a bad ground some how.

motorvated 12-30-2008 10:15 PM

Yea they are simple, I dont know what the issue is. I dont want to keep splicing into wires in my harness to test the REM.

revhi 12-30-2008 10:17 PM

By jumping the 12v from battery to the remote, you insured the amp was getting 12v remote turn on, so it is not your remote wire that is the issue.

motorvated 12-30-2008 10:19 PM

Maybe you misunderstood... the amp didnt do ANYTHING when I jumped it.

revhi 12-30-2008 10:25 PM

Right, by doing that your amp did not turn on. If it was a bad remote wire from your radio, the amp would have turned on. It means your 12v from battery is not getting 12v to your amp, or your ground is bad.

motorvated 12-30-2008 10:27 PM

OO wow..cool. That works the opposite way I thought it would work. I thought if it was wired right, it would have turned on. Running out to check my fuses..AGAIN

motorvated 12-30-2008 10:29 PM

ugh...someone shoot me. Fuse from battery to amp is blown. NO idea how. Brand new install kit. 50A fuse. how the fck does that blow
